数据库需要什么系统配置
-
配置数据库系统需要考虑以下几个方面:
-
硬件配置:数据库系统需要一定的硬件资源来保证其正常运行。首先是处理器,数据库系统对处理器的要求较高,需要一定的处理能力来处理大量的查询请求。其次是内存,数据库系统需要一定的内存来存储数据缓存和索引信息。此外,硬盘空间也是必不可少的,数据库系统需要存储大量的数据文件。因此,硬件配置应该包括足够的处理器核心、足够的内存和足够的硬盘空间。
-
操作系统:数据库系统需要在特定的操作系统上运行。常用的数据库系统如MySQL、Oracle和SQL Server都支持多种操作系统,包括Windows、Linux和Unix等。选择合适的操作系统是保证数据库系统正常运行的关键。
-
数据库软件:数据库系统需要合适的数据库软件来管理数据。常用的数据库软件有MySQL、Oracle、SQL Server等。选择合适的数据库软件取决于应用需求、预算和技术要求等因素。
-
网络配置:如果数据库需要通过网络进行访问,网络配置也是必不可少的。要确保网络带宽足够,以便支持多个用户同时访问数据库。此外,网络安全也是非常重要的,数据库系统应该配置防火墙、访问控制和加密等安全措施。
-
数据备份和恢复:数据库系统应该配置合适的备份和恢复策略,以保证数据的安全性和可靠性。定期备份数据并将备份文件存储在安全的位置,同时测试备份文件的可恢复性。此外,还应该配置合适的事务日志和归档机制,以便在出现故障时能够及时恢复数据。
总结起来,配置数据库系统需要考虑硬件配置、操作系统、数据库软件、网络配置和数据备份和恢复等多个方面。根据具体的应用需求和技术要求,选择合适的配置方案,以保证数据库系统的正常运行和数据的安全性。
1年前 -
-
数据库的系统配置是指为了保证数据库的正常运行,所需的硬件和软件环境的设置。下面将从硬件配置和软件配置两方面来介绍数据库所需的系统配置。
硬件配置:
- CPU:数据库对CPU的要求较高,因为数据库的查询和处理需要大量的计算能力。建议选择性能较好的多核CPU。
- 内存:数据库的性能与内存密切相关,足够的内存可以提高数据库的读写速度。对于大型数据库,建议分配至少16GB的内存。
- 存储设备:数据库的存储设备应具备较高的读写速度和容量。固态硬盘(SSD)是较为理想的选择,因为它们具有更快的数据访问速度和更高的稳定性。
- 网络带宽:数据库的性能也受限于网络带宽。如果数据库需要通过网络访问,需要保证网络带宽足够,以避免网络延迟和数据传输速度过慢的问题。
软件配置:
- 操作系统:数据库可以在各种操作系统上运行,如Windows、Linux和Unix等。根据数据库的具体要求选择合适的操作系统,并及时更新操作系统的补丁和安全更新。
- 数据库管理系统(DBMS):根据具体需求选择合适的DBMS,如MySQL、Oracle、SQL Server等。安装和配置DBMS时,需要根据实际情况进行参数调整和性能优化。
- 防火墙和安全软件:为了保护数据库的安全,应配置防火墙和安全软件,以防止未经授权的访问和恶意攻击。
- 备份和恢复工具:配置数据库的备份和恢复工具是非常重要的,以保证数据的安全性和可靠性。
此外,还需要考虑数据库的负载和访问模式,根据实际情况进行性能测试和优化,以提高数据库的性能和可用性。数据库的系统配置需要根据具体的应用场景和需求进行调整,以上只是一些一般性的建议。
1年前 -
数据库系统的配置需求会根据不同的数据库管理系统(DBMS)和使用情况而有所不同。以下是一般情况下数据库系统所需的系统配置要求。
-
处理器(CPU):数据库系统对于处理器的要求较高,因为数据库操作通常需要大量的计算和处理能力。多核心和高频率的处理器可以提供更好的性能。一般来说,至少需要双核心处理器,但对于大型数据库系统,更高的核心数和更高的频率会更有利。
-
内存(RAM):内存是数据库系统性能的重要因素之一。数据库需要将数据和索引存储在内存中以提高访问速度。因此,足够的内存对于数据库系统来说至关重要。一般来说,至少需要4GB的内存,但对于大型数据库系统,更高的内存容量可以提供更好的性能。
-
存储设备:数据库需要可靠且高性能的存储设备来存储数据和索引。传统的机械硬盘(HDD)可以满足基本需求,但固态硬盘(SSD)可以提供更高的读写速度和更好的性能。此外,使用RAID技术可以提高存储的容错性和性能。
-
操作系统:数据库系统可以在多种操作系统上运行,包括Windows、Linux和Unix等。选择操作系统时,需要考虑数据库管理系统的兼容性、性能和稳定性。
-
网络:对于分布式数据库系统或需要远程访问的数据库系统,稳定和高速的网络连接是必需的。网络带宽和延迟对于数据库系统的性能和响应时间有重要影响。
-
数据库管理系统:不同的数据库管理系统有不同的配置需求。根据具体的数据库管理系统,可能需要安装和配置特定的软件和服务。
-
安全性:数据库系统需要适当的安全配置来保护数据的机密性、完整性和可用性。这包括访问控制、身份验证、加密和备份等安全措施。
总之,数据库系统的配置需求是一个复杂的问题,需要综合考虑硬件、软件和网络等方面的因素。根据具体的需求和预算,可以选择合适的配置来满足数据库系统的性能和安全需求。
1年前 -